App Inventor 2

Description

Mapa mental complejo y completo acerca de App Inventor 2
JuanF Grisales
Mind Map by JuanF Grisales, updated 8 months ago
JuanF Grisales
Created by JuanF Grisales over 1 year ago
8
0

Resource summary

App Inventor 2
  1. ¿Que es?
    1. "Soy la 2da version de App Inventor 1 con varios mejoras, obviamente, utilizada para la creacion basica y sencilla de apps moviles para Google Play, Play Store entre otras plataformas mas. Fui creada por el grandioso equipo del MIT (Massachussets Institutive Technology)"
    2. ¿Para que sirve?
      1. Al igual que su antecesora, App Inventor 2 esta destinada a la creacion basica y sencilla de diversos tipos aplicaciones 100% funcionales de forma gratuita tales como:
        1. Apps de mensajeria instantanea
          1. Videojuegos Indie o 3D
            1. Accesible para los sistemas operativos:
              1. Android
                1. iOS
            2. Lenguaje o forma de Programacion
              1. Su ingente basicidad se debe, principalmente, a su instintivo y anaquial software de programacion. Se basa en bloque s digitales de LEGO sin su aspecto fisico, por supuesto, al igual que Scratch y a diferencia de los demas... Fue programada en:
                1. Java Scheme
              2. Interfaz Grafica
                1. Consiste en una pantalla de fondo blanco con una barra verde en la parte superior debajo de otra gris clara con las opciones principales de la App y una columna con diverosos bloques y/o funciones
                  1. Tambien, consiste en 3 herramientas las cuales son:
                    1. Editor de Bloques
                      1. Entorno o pantalla donde debemos programar el proyecto a realizar despues de haber ejecutado el entorno de diseñador, obviamente
                      2. Diseñador
                        1. Entorno o pantalla donde podemos crear el proyecto deseado y visualizar los avances en el mismo.
                        2. Gestor de proyectos
                          1. entorno o pantalla donde podemos guardar el proyecto realizado o ejecutar acciones similares
                    2. Interfaz de programacion
                      1. Consiste en en una pantalla con una barra verde, una coumna con diversos bloques de programacion y con diversas opciones secundarias como guardado, visualizar, etc... En fin; se compone de las siguientes herramientas:
                        1. 1) Bloques (Control, Logica, Texto, etc,,,)
                          1. 2) Herramientas de basura / Eliminar Bloque
                            1. 3) Herramienta de moral / Copiar Bloques
                              1. 4) Añadir Archivo
                                1. 5) Designar / Publicar
                                  1. 6) Añadir Pantalla, etc...
                                2. Sistemas Operativos
                                  1. Estas programando una micro:bit virtualmente y necesitas que funcione la micro:bit fisica que tienes ¿Que necesitas? ¡Un Cable USB! En App Inventor 2 necesitaras el mismo procedimiento para poder ejecutar tu App en un dispositivo Android o iOS conectado a una PC con los siguientes sistemas operativos:
                                    1. GNU/ / Linux: Ubunta 8+, Debian 5+
                                      1. Macintosh (Con procesador Intel): Mac OS X 10.5, 10.6
                                        1. Windows: Windows XP, Windows Vista, Windows 7
                                      2. Proceso de Registro en App Inventor 2
                                        1. 1) Abre el siguiente enlace https://appinventor.mit.edu/
                                          1. 2) Haz click en el boton superior naranja "Crear!"
                                            1. 3) Ingresa tu cuenta personal (gmail, hotmail, yahoo, etc...)
                                              1. 4) Lee los terminos de uso y politicas de privacidad. Aceptalos si estas de acuerdo con ellos...
                                        2. Servicios de adjuntamiento (OPCIONAL)
                                          1. Se le pueden anexar a App Inventor 2 un sinnumero de servicios para mejorar su funcionamiento o agregar nuevas funciones; entre los cuales destacan:
                                            1. TinyDB
                                              1. Es el servicio predeterminado de App Inventor 2. Es un almacen de datos de forma definitiva y permanente; osea, no te eliminara para nada el proyecto creado, asi el dispositivo se dañe o se rompa.
                                              2. Google Fusion Tables
                                                1. Es un servicio Web de Google para la gestion y guardado de datos. En esta, podras ver tu propia informacion guardada y descargarla de manera segura y rapida.
                                                2. SPSS
                                                  1. Es un programa estadistico informatico que tan solo se utilizaba en las ciencias financieras y sociales. Ahora, se puede utilizar en App Inventor 2, debido a su ingente base de datos que se utiliza, principlmente para finanzas.
                                                  2. FireBase
                                                    1. Es un programa y/o plataforma destinada a la creacion de Apps Web y Moviles. No se utiliza como base de datos; no obstante, podras crear chats para App Inventor 2 siendo el limite propuesto tu creatividad.
                                                    2. CloudDB
                                                      1. Es un programa estadistico, al igual que SPSS, utilizado para las finanzas , economia y ciencias sociales. Con ella, puedes guardar la informacion de tus proyectos de App Inventor 2 en su respectiva base de datos
                                                  3. EJEMPLO
                                                    1. Botones con Audio - App Inventor 2 https://www.youtube.com/watch?v=LnHJkZ-eZaQ
                                                      1. En este proyecto, vamos a ver claramente la programacion nivel medio (Un ejemplo nivel medio)que se puede realizar en App Inventor 2
                                                        1. OK; empezemos... este proyecto consiste en el clickeo hacia un boton de un personaje especifico, por lo general; el cual, al ser clickead, emitira una especie de sonido de rabia o sorpresa. Bien; los personajes son:
                                                          1. 1) Gato: *Click* Aullido de Gato
                                                            1. 2) Perro: *Click*Ladrido de Perro
                                                              1. 3) Caballo: *Click* Graznido de Caballo
                                                                1. 4) Buzz lightyear: *Click* Al infinito y mas alla
                                                                  1. 5) Homero: *Click* Grito de Homero
                                                                    1. 6) Iron Man: *Click* Hola, salvaje villano. Te voy a derrotar
                                                              Show full summary Hide full summary

                                                              Similar

                                                              Construcción de software
                                                              CRHISTIAN SUAREZ
                                                              Materials (vocabulary)
                                                              Jesús García
                                                              Diapositivas de Topología de Redes
                                                              lisi_98
                                                              Elementos que conforman a google chrome
                                                              juan carlos hernandez morales
                                                              Sistema de Gestor de Base de Datos MongoDB
                                                              Edwin Herlop
                                                              Tarea 1 - La Naturaleza de la Electricidad
                                                              Paula Andrea
                                                              TRABAJO DE TOPOLOGÍA DE REDES
                                                              lisi_98
                                                              Arquitecturas de Sistemas Distribuidos
                                                              Edisson Reinozo
                                                              el computador y sus partes
                                                              Lia Saori Mukai Abreu
                                                              Robots
                                                              Ely Z
                                                              SISTEMAS OPERATIVOS
                                                              miguel angel ramirez lopez